Rederive Mice

Strain rederivation, by embryo transfer, is a management tool to clean a mouse line from pathogen infection or to import mice into a barrier facility from outside vivarium. We offer rederivation service by IVF or ICSI followed by embryo transfer. Sperm cryopreservation is highly recommended for the mutant male being used for IVF or ICSI, if the mutant male is the only male available or limited in number.

Embryos derived by IVF or ICSI are cultured overnight to the 2-cell stage, and then surgically transferred into the oviducts of pseudopregnant female recipients 0.5 day post coitum. If no pups are obtained from the first IVF or ICSI, we will repeat the procedure once at no additional charge

Mouse numbers required for rederivation:

For heterozygous line rederivation, we like to receive 3 males from our customer, and we will purchase the female mice as egg donors for IVF, but please specify which vendor (i.e., Taconic, Charles River, Harland, JAX) you like.  For homozygous line rederivation, we like to receive 3 males and 10-15 females per line from our customer. The perfect male age is 8-12 weeks old, and the perfect female age is 3-4 weeks old.
